Public records show Ravenswood, Ripley, Charleston and 4 other cities as cities Melissa also stayed in. Melissa has listed (304) 273-2252 as her phone number. 2107 42Nd St, Parkersburg, Wv 26104 is where Melissa resides. This person's birth year is 1973. We have found 9 possible relatives of Melissa: Steven Russell Beha, Herman Prev Robinson, Jeffrey B Huffman and 6 other people. Melissa was born 51 years ago.